Guv and CM offer tributes to Bhagwan Birsa Munda on his death anniversary

Ranchi. Jun 9: Jharkhand Governor Draupadi Murmu and Chief Minister Raghubar Das offered floral tributes to Bhagwan Birsa Munda on his death anniversary here.

 

The duo reached the Samadhi Sthal of Birsa Munda located ay Kokar here and offered their tributes and also garlanded his statue.

Speaking on the occasion Mr Das said that Bhagwan Birsa Munda gave up his life to fight against exploitation, poverty and bondage. He wanted to create a society which would be free from exploitation and poverty and also wanted to keep his culture intact. Therefore efforst should be made so that teh culture of the state is not influences from outside, Mr Das said.

 

The Chief Minister said that by following on the path showed by him the Jharkhand of his dreams would be built. He said that Jharkhand was moving ahead on the path of progress and there was a need to extend cooperation by all the stakeholders in this development journey.

Later the duo reached Birsa Chowk of the state capital where they garlanded the statue of Birsa Munda. Later the Governor in a function organised at Darbar Hall of the Raj Bhawan garlanded teh statue of Bhagwan Birsa Munda.

 

Former Jharkhand Chief Minister Arjun Munda alongwith his wife Meera Munda too offered tributes at Samadhi Sthal of Birsa Munda at Kokar. Later Mr Munda reached Birsa Chowk and garlanded the statue of Biras Munda.
